What Happens When the Land Gets Cut

Brush hogging in Carencro starts with a walkthrough or review of your property to identify obstacles like hidden fence posts, debris, or low spots that could damage equipment. The tractor-mounted cutter moves across the land in passes, cutting down tall grass, brush, vines, and small woody growth. The work is noisy and leaves cut vegetation scattered across the ground, which decomposes over time or can be raked and removed depending on your needs.

After the service is complete, you will see open ground where dense growth used to block access and visibility. Fence lines become visible again, driveways and paths reappear, and the property looks maintained rather than abandoned. The land is not finished to lawn quality, but it is cleared enough to walk, assess, or prepare for the next phase of development or use.

Brush hogging does not remove stumps, roots, or large trees, and it is not suitable for properties with steep slopes or areas too soft for tractor travel. Debris cleanup and grading are separate services. How thick can the brush be for hogging to work?
Brush hogging handles grass, weeds, vines, and woody growth up to several inches in diameter. Larger saplings or mature trees require different equipment and are not included in standard brush hogging services.
What will my property look like after the service?
Your property in Carencro will be cleared down to a rough, manageable height with cut vegetation left on the ground. It will not look like a mowed lawn, but you will be able to see the land, walk it, and use it again.
Do you remove the cut material after hogging?
Cut vegetation is left in place to decompose unless debris removal is arranged separately. If you need the material raked, hauled, or cleared for construction, mention that when booking so those services can be coordinated.
When is the best time to schedule brush hogging?
Brush hogging works year-round in Carencro, but scheduling during drier months reduces the chance of equipment getting stuck in soft ground. If your property tends to hold water, plan the work when the soil is firm.
What should I do before the crew arrives?
Mark any hidden obstacles like fence posts, pipes, wells, or debris piles so the operator can avoid them. Clearing large trash or metal from the site beforehand prevents equipment damage and keeps the work moving efficiently.
